Why Holiday or Seasonal Ring Sales Should be a Red Flag

Sometimes you’ll see “discounted engagement rings” advertised around Valentine’s Day, Black Friday, and other holidays. But often, those sales come with fine print, limited options, and a lot of pressure. Shouldn’t it be a bit of a red flag if a retailer can discount a diamond ring by 50% and still make a profit?

During high-volume seasons, inventory can be picked over, jewelers may be too busy for thoughtful consultation, and you may end up rushing an incredibly important decision. In some cases, retailers raise their prices before running sales, so that so-called “deal” might not actually save you much at all.

Common Engagement Ring Timing Myths

Let’s clear up a few of the most common myths:

  • Myth: You need to wait until you can afford the “perfect” ring.
    Many guys hold off on buying an engagement ring because they think they need to save for the biggest, most impressive diamond possible. But the truth is, the perfect ring is the one that’s meaningful and fits your current stage of life. There is no reason to go into debt or delay your proposal chasing a carat size. There are beautiful, high-quality options, including lab-grown diamonds and customizable designs, that fit a wide range of budgets and styles.
  • Myth: Diamonds are cheapest in January.
    While demand might dip after the holidays, quality diamonds are priced based on availability and market value, not the month.
  • Myth: You have to propose during the holidays.
    Holiday proposals can be wonderful if that is a season that best suits your relationship and you feel ready to pursue marriage. However, the best time to propose is when you’re both ready to make a lifelong commitment, regardless of the time of year.

When to Shop Based on Your Proposal Date

Work Backward from Your Proposal Date

If you have a proposal date in mind, begin planning by working backward from that day. Custom rings take time to design, approve, and create, and even pre-designed styles often need adjustments or resizing. Starting early gives you the freedom to personalize every detail without feeling rushed, so the ring is just as thoughtful as the moment you propose.

Use this quick guide:

  • 3–4 months before: Start researching ring styles, budgets, and jewelers.
  • 2–3 months before: Begin narrowing down styles and consulting with jewelers.
  • 1–2 months before: Finalize your ring, make the purchase, and allow time for delivery. 

Planning ahead allows you to focus on what truly matters rather than feeling like you have to scramble at the last minute.
